Output 10399860111b7f5223147fec5362086cfe17df3ed615d45b9dbbe43ec4b72b32:0

value
1051367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2c93f188554d0007e6c5d0ad0eff872b0da41c OP_EQUAL
address
3A6PVX4ySGgy93M3srTRQvPsV3JAfr7z26
transaction
10399860111b7f5223147fec5362086cfe17df3ed615d45b9dbbe43ec4b72b32
confirmations
392189
spent
true